Paradigm Building Contractors (PBC) is a prominent construction company based in Washington, established in 2009 by co-owners Rina Hernandez, Jonathan Hernandez, and Saul de la Torre. The company specializes in a variety of construction services including metal stud framing, gypsum wallboard installation and finishing, acoustical ceilings, insulation, and painting. PBC has successfully completed hundreds of projects, making it a recognized name in the region's commercial and multifamily residential construction sectors.
As a family-run business, Paradigm Building Contractors prides itself on being minority-owned and women-led, actively contributing to the representation of diverse leadership within the construction industry.
